Evans, Georgia, is a thriving suburban community in Columbia County, part of the larger Augusta metropolitan area. With a population that has grown significantly over the years, it offers a family-friendly atmosphere and serves as the de facto county seat, housing important government facilities. Its proximity to Augusta makes it an attractive location for those who want the benefits of suburban living while remaining close to city amenities. The community is known for its welcoming vibe and is a popular choice for families and individuals seeking a community-oriented lifestyle.

Spring is a pleasant time to visit Evans, with mild temperatures and blooming landscapes.
Summers can be hot, but it's a great time to enjoy outdoor activities and community events.
Fall offers cooler temperatures and is ideal for exploring local parks and trails.
Winters are mild, making it a good time for indoor activities and exploring local history.
